Instructor, History

Instructor, History

Guilford Technical Community CollegeNorth Carolina, United States
30+ days ago
Job type
  • Full-time
Job description

Description

Teaching faculty at Guilford Technical Community College are responsible for supporting student success by creating an optimum learning environment, responding to student needs, managing effective instructional activities, modeling employability skills, demonstrating professionalism, developing cooperative work relationships with other faculty and staff, supporting college administrative requirements, and maintaining competency in their instructional field. He / she will be responsible for quality instruction and for effective participation and interest in the total affairs of the college.

Under general supervision, this individual will prepare and teach courses designed for transfer and support of career technical programs. These courses may include : HIS111 – World Civilization I, HIS112 – World Civilization II, HIS131 – American History I, HIS132 – American History II.

Duties / Functions

Teaching

Prepare & teach departmental courses to include :

  • developing learner centered lesson plans
  • employing teaching strategies & instructional materials for different learning styles
  • incorporating, as pedagogically appropriate, current technology in classroom, distance learning and laboratory environments
  • creating and modeling a quality learning environment that supports a diverse student population
  • preparing, distributing and utilizing instructional support materials, including course syllabi, supplementary materials, instructional media and other devices as appropriate
  • conducting appropriate assessment of student learning outcomes in courses and programs / general education as appropriate

    Education Required

  • Master’s degree in History or a related field from a regionally accredited university with a minimum of 18 graduate semester hour credits in History.
  • Education Preferred

  • Doctoral degree in History from a regionally accredited university
  • Experience Required

  • Post-secondary teaching experience in History
  • Experience Preferred

  • Community college teaching experience
  • Experience with assessment of student learning outcomes
  • Experience with distance learning and / or alternate instructional delivery systems
